When I read the recent letter regarding students attending our schools who do not live in this county I became outraged. The letter writer’s observation probably just scratched the surface of what is going on. How can the schools allow this to happen?

We have students in trailers and are building new schools to house all these students. If we remove the ones who do not belong here, maybe the overcrowding would be eased. Why should the taxpayers in this county pay for out-of-county students? They are bringing down our test scores, too.

With the tax money we save we could hire additional personnel to police this situation. My understanding is that it costs over $8,200 per year to educate a child in Fayette County. Just do the math. We are being robbed.
